Irène Drésel, an electro artist somewhere between Vitalic and Solomun, made history in 2023 as the first woman to win the César for Best Original Score. She creates vibrant techno music that is as sensual as it is direct, inspired by a rich, magnetic, sonic, and visual universe. After two consecutive EPs, "Rita" (2017) and "Icône" (2018), her debut album "Hyper Cristal" was released in spring 2019. This was followed by a second album, "Kinky Dogma," in 2021, which Libération described as "a sophisticated, ambitious yet unpretentious techno work, as it never loses sight of its creator's goal: to provoke an irresistible exhilaration in the listener." She promoted these projects through numerous concerts, including a sold-out show at Le Trianon, a show at La Cigale that sold out in 24 hours, and major festivals (including Printemps de Bourges, Fnac Live, Les Vieilles Charrues, and Arte Concert). With over 5,000 cumulative sales from her previous works, her third album, "Rose Fluo," will be celebrated at L'Olympia in May 2024.
